										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The spooky month of October is almost behind us already as time marches on. One good thing about that is always that our various game subscription services (of which there is so many nowadays, it seems) has a refresh for a group of new games for us to enjoy. Microsoft has announced the line up for Games with Gold in November, and it&#8217;s a nice mix of various titles.</p>
<p>First up, for the entire month will be <em>Moving Out</em>, an indie title all about your small business doing what it can to help a town in their various mover needs. From November 16th into December will be <em>Kingdom Two Crowns</em>, where you a play a monarch trying to protect their kingdom from invaders and other peril. On the 360 side, there is also <em>Lego Batman 2: DC Superheroes</em>, the sequel to the hit Lego-themed game that brought in other DC characters into Gotham, which will be available November 16th to the 30th, and then <em>Rocket Knight</em>, a revival of a Sega Genesis IP, that will be there from the 1st to the 15th.</p>
<p>The games will begin being available starting November 1st and will be available to redeem on all Xbox Series X/S and Xbox One consoles, with <em>Lego Batman 2</em> and <em>Rocket Knight</em> also being available on the 360.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Somehow, June has mostly come and gone, which means <a href="https://news.xbox.com/en-us/2021/06/29/new-games-with-gold-for-july-2021/">July, and its Games With Gold, have been revealed by the folks at Xbox</a>. It&#8217;s shaking up to be a solid month, with four games spread across July. Two of the games will be Xbox One and Xbox Series X|S titles, while another two will run via backwards compatibility. The Xbox One and Xbox Series X|S titles are <em>Planet Alpha</em> and <em>Rock of Ages 3: Make &amp; Break, </em>while the backwards compatibility titles are <em>Conker: Live and Reloaded</em> and <em>Midway Arcade Origins</em>.</p>
<p>In <em>Planet Alpha</em>, players are marooned on a strange planet and will have to venture through beautiful and dangerous environments to unlock the planet&#8217;s secrets, escape relentless enemies, and harness the power of both night and day to survive. <em>Rock of Ages 3: Make &amp; Break </em>combines a sprawling story with wild takes on legendary characters from history and fiction. Players can also design, build, and share custom levels with friends in what is both a ridiculous tower defense and arcade games.</p>
<p><em>Conker: Live and Reloaded </em>is a remake of N64 classic <em>Conker&#8217;s Bad Fur Day </em>in which players guide the foul-mouthed squirrel through a &#8220;raunchy world full of twisted characters, innuendos, and outrageous movie parodies.&#8221; <em>Midway Arcade Origins</em>, meanwhile, collects more than 30 arcade games including <em>Defender</em>, <em>Gauntlet</em>, <em>Rampart</em>, and more, without requiring any quarters.</p>
<p>The games combine for an MSRP of $79.96 and 3000 gamerscore. <em>Planet Alpha</em> will be available from July 1st to 31st. <em>Rock of Ages 3: Make &amp; Break</em> will be available from July 16th to August 15th. <em>Conker: Live and Reloaded</em> can be claimed from July 1st to 15th, and <em>Injustice</em> can be picked up from July 16th to 31st.</p>

<p>Microsoft has announced the games for Xbox Live Games With Gold for the month of July, and&#8230; after a few great months, this month&#8217;s offerings are definitely disappointing. On the Xbox One, <em>Runbow</em>, as well as Ubisoft&#8217;s follow up to <em>Grow Home</em>, <em>Grow Up</em>, this month.</p>
<p>Xbox 360 users will get <em>LEGO Pirates of the Caribbean</em>, one of the most forgettable LEGO games to date, and <em>Kane and Lynch 2</em>, a maligned sequel to an even more maligned game; both of these games will of course also be playable on the Xbox One, but again, that&#8217;s not going to really make the selection that much better.</p>
<p>After some consistently great months, I suppose a slump was to be expected. Still, this gives Sony an easy in to have the better lineup for this month- they had an excellent selection last month, headlined by <em>Life is Strange</em> on the PS4- hopefully they don&#8217;t drop the ball this month, either.</p>

<p>April will probably be the very best month that Microsoft&#8217;s Games With Gold service has had yet- the games for this month will include four rather good titles, across Xbox 360 and Xbox One both- which means that subscribers will be getting some real bang for their buck here.</p>
<p>Over on the Xbox One, the two headlining titles include Telltale&#8217;s <em>The Walking Dead Season 2</em>, and Crytek&#8217;s <em>Ryse: Son of Rome</em>. While the latter particularly was panned upon release, it <em>is</em> the kind of game that most people would be all to happy to give a shot themselves if they didn&#8217;t have to actually pay for it- which makes it a perfect fit here.</p>
<p>On the Xbox 360 end (with these games, of course, being playable on Xbox One, too), you&#8217;ll have <em>Assassin&#8217;s Creed Revelations</em> (one of the weaker games in the series, but still not a bad title at all), and <em>Darksiders</em> (an excellent <em>Zelda</em> like game, that I do think is the best of the titles on offer this month).</p>

<p>Not that long ago, Microsoft&#8217;s Games with gold service for Xbox Live was considered to be a bit of a joke, with the games Microsoft offering frequently being bottom of the barrel- something that made them look even poorer compared to the then excellent offerings that Sony used to make on PS+.</p>
<p>However, over the last few months, the tables have now changed, with Microsoft putting in the effort to make Games With Gold more attractive to subscribers, while PS+ has gotten steadily less appealing over time. <a href="https://twitter.com/majornelson/status/735123751893905408">And this month&#8217;s Games with Gold offering is another strong showing from Microsoft</a>, making another compelling case for Xbox owners to subscribe to Xbox Live Gold.</p>
<p>On offer this month for the Xbox One are Ubisoft&#8217;s <em>The Crew</em>, their open world racing MMO; also available will be <em>Goat Simulator</em>. In addition, Xbox 360 players get <em>XCOM: Enemy Unknown</em> and <em>Super Meat Boy</em>, both of which will also be available to Xbox one players thanks to the console&#8217;s backwards compatibility.</p>
<p>It&#8217;s a very strong month- and I am having a very hard time seeing Sony top this with PS+.</p>

<p>Last month&#8217;s Games With Gold was excellent, featuring probably the best showing yet for Microsoft&#8217;s service, when the company gave away <em>Sunset Overdrive</em>, which remains to this day one of the best games on the Xbox One, and arguably still its best exclusive, for free.</p>
<p>This month&#8217;s offerings, by contrast, are a decided step down. In May, it seems like Microsoft will be offering some rather poor titles to subscribers- the Xbox One offerings are headlined by <em>Defense Grid 2</em> and <em>Costume Quest 2</em>, while the Xbox 360 fares a bit better with <em>Grid 2</em> and <em>Peggle. </em></p>
<p>As always, Xbox One players at least get to play the Xbox 360 games as well, but seriously- after last month&#8217;s great showing, this will probably cause a lot of people to be very, very pissed.</p>
<p>Sony, the ball is now in your court- it should not be too difficult to outdo Microsoft&#8217;s showing this month with whatever PS+ has planned. Then again, Sony have made it a habit to disappoint people beyond what was previously thought possible, so who knows, really.</p>

<p><a href="http://majornelson.com/2016/03/24/xbox-live-games-with-gold-for-april-2016/" target="_blank">Xbox Live&#8217;s Games with Gold program received what might actually be its best month ever</a>&#8211; this month, subscribers of Xbox Live get some extremely great games, including what is possibly still the best exclusive on the platform so far.</p>
<p>Subscribers of Xbox Live Gold will be getting Insomniac&#8217;s excellent third person action/platformer hybrid <em>Sunset Overdrive, </em>as well as the full first season of Telltale&#8217;s remarkable <em>The Wolf Among Us </em>on the Xbox One. <em>Sunset Overdrive</em> launched in late 2014, and it remains, to this day, one of the best exclusives on the system.</p>
<p>Xbox 360 owners are pretty well served too, getting a copy of <em>Saints Row: The Third</em>, as well as <em>Dead Space</em>&#8211; both of these games will also be playable, and available, on Xbox One, making this, on the whole, one of the best months of free games ever, between Xbox Live <em>and</em> PS+.</p>
<p>Sony will have to work really hard to actually outdo Microsoft this month- which seems unlikely, given their track record with really terrible crappy offerings of late.</p>

<p>For the last few months, Xbox Live&#8217;s Games With Gold initiative has really stepped up its offerings- Assassin&#8217;s Creed IV: Black Flag, Valiant Hearts, Metal Gear Solid V: Ground Zeroes, The Walking Dead, and Metro are just some excellent games that have been put up on the service for Xbox One owners.</p>
<p>Which makes this month&#8217;s offering so much worse by comparison.</p>
<p>First, the silver lining- with the official release of the Backwards Compatibility initiative for the Xbox One starting this month, Xbox Live Gold members will get four games every month- the two Xbox One games that they usually get, plus two more games, since all Games with Gold Xbox 360 games will be backwards compatible on the Xbox One.</p>
<p>Now for the actual lineup of games this month. It&#8217;s pretty bad, so brace yourself:</p>
<ul>
<li>Pneuma: Breath of Life (Xbox One)</li>
<li>Knight Squad (Xbox One)</li>
<li>DiRT 3 (Xbox 360)</li>
<li>Dungeon Siege III (Xbox 360)</li>
</ul>
<p>I guess we had to have an off month eventually. Hopefully PS+&#8217;s Instant Game Collection does not disappoint this month.</p>
